President Karzai Meets Lithuanian, Iranian Heads of State 
 
Presidents Karzai and AhmadinejadOn September 20, President Karzai met with the Lithuanian and Iranian heads of state on the fringes of the UN General Assembly in New York.

In his meeting with Valdas Adamkus, President of Lithuania, the two presidents discussed Lithuania’s continuing assistance to Afghanistan’s security through its PRT based in the province of Ghor.

President Karzai thanked President Adamkus for Lithuania’s assistance and stressed the need to expand bilateral relations.

President Karzai also met with Mahmoud Ahmadinejad, President of the Islamic Republic of Iran, and discussed strengthening bilateral relations between the two neighbors.

The two presidents called the execution of agreements between Afghanistan, Iran, and Tajikistan reached earlier this year in Dushanbe as crucial to the expansion of cooperation.

President Karzai thanked President Ahmadinejad for Iran’s assistance to the reconstruction effort in Afghanistan, and invited him to visit Kabul in the near future.

President Karzai is due to leave New York for an official visit to Ottawa, Canada later this evening.
